A Number of Clear Thinking Hints for the Casinos
As an avid player, I have found out a few important lessons while betting over the years. It doesn’t matter if you are partial to gambling at the ‘bricks and mortar’ type or the numerous internet casinos. Here are my all important rules of betting, most of which can be seen as common sense, but if abide by they will help you go a long distance to departing with a smile on your face.
Rule 1: Go into a casino with a predetermined figure that you are willing and can afford to use – How much would you spend for a night out on diner, alcoholic beverages, cover charges and tips? This is a great sum to utilize.
Rule 2: Don’t carry your cash card with you – or any way of withdrawing cash out. Don’t worry about money for the cab if you lose all your money; most taxi drivers, specifically the taxis booked through casinos, will drive you to your house and will be more than happy to wait for the moolah when you get home.
Rule three: Stay to your predetermined cutoff. I always think of what I would want to buy if I earn. The last time I went, I decided I would would love to purchase a new Media Player which retailed at $400, so that was my upper cap. As soon as I surpassed this amount, I stopped. Just stop. Even if Mystic Megan herself gives you the upcoming number for the roulette wheel, pay no attention to her and say goodbye. Leave Secure in the understanding that you will be going into the city and acquiring a great new toy!
